Session handling for the Prosewright doc linter is stateless: each lint run opens a session against the Quillgate service, which expires after thirty minutes idle. Do not reuse sessions across repositories; the linter keys its rule cache to the session, and stale caches cause false positives in cross-reference checks. Renew by calling the refresh endpoint before expiry rather than after. All contractor sessions run against the sandbox tier, never production. To start a sandbox session, pass the bearer token below.

portal login ticket: eyJhbGciOiJIUzI1NiIsInR5cCI6IkpXVCJ9.eyJzdWIiOiI0Z4ywpUMsBIn0.ca5FVhkdBXa3

Subject: Quickstore 4.2 — bloom filter now fronts the KV layer

Plugin authors: starting with this release, Quickstore places a bloom filter ahead of the key-value store. Negative lookups return faster; false positives fall through safely. No API changes are required on your side. Verify your plugin against the staging build referenced below.

session token of fahif-tadup = htk3_9c7

Management Meeting Minutes — Quillart Trading Group

Branch managers convened to finalise the discount policy for large deals. Orders above 500 units may receive up to 8% discount at branch discretion; anything beyond requires sign-off from regional director Pavel Ostryn. Jonna Felke raised concerns about margin erosion on the Marlowe fixture range; a quarterly review was agreed. Updated price sheets circulate Friday. Managers must log all exceptions in the central register. The confidential commentary on pricing strategy follows below.

internal memo for kaguf-yajog: Headcount on the Druath team goes from 30 to 70 by the end of November. Gross margin on Druath came in at 56 percent against a plan of 28 percent.

**Mail Room Relocation — Facilities Desk Notes**

From the 14th, the mail room at Ashgrove Place moves from the basement to level 1, beside the loading bay. Redirect couriers accordingly and update the signage at both lifts. Parcels awaiting collection are now held in the secure cage, which you can open using the code below.

badge for fafop-fajof: bdg-Z-47